Baked Feta (Serves 4)

Ingredients
250g Feta
1 tomato seeded and diced
½ red chilli sliced
Leaves from 3 sprigs thyme, plus extra to garnish
1 cove garlic
1 tbsp olive oil

Method
Preheat oven to 180C. Place feta in an ovenproof dish or in tin foil. Place remaining ingredients in a small bowl and toss to combine. Pour over the feta, cover with foil and bake for 20 minutes. Garnish with fresh thyme and serve hot with crusty bread as the perfect snack with drinks.
